Autodesk.Revit.DB.WorksetVisibility类是Revit API中的一个类,用于表示Revit文档中的工作视图(work view)的可见性。
在Revit中,工作视图是可在其中编辑和定位元素的视图。此类包含属性和方法,使您能够控制此类视图的可见性。
以下是Autodesk.Revit.DB.WorksetVisibility类中可用的属性:
以下是Autodesk.Revit.DB.WorksetVisibility类中可用的方法:
以下是使用Autodesk.Revit.DB.WorksetVisibility类的一些示例:
UIDocument uiDoc = uidoc;
Document doc = uiDoc.Document;
WorksetId worksetId = new WorksetId(1);
WorksetVisibility worksetVisibility = new WorksetVisibility(false, true, true);
doc.SetWorksetVisibility(worksetId, worksetVisibility);
UIDocument uiDoc = uidoc;
Document doc = uiDoc.Document;
View view = uiDoc.ActiveView;
WorksetVisibility worksetVisibility = view.GetWorksetVisibility();
worksetVisibility.IsAnnotationVisible = false;
view.SetWorksetVisibility(worksetVisibility);
Autodesk.Revit.DB.WorksetVisibility类在Revit API中提供了很好的工具,用于控制工作视图的可见性。通过使用这个类,您可以方便地设置工作视图的显示方式,以更好地满足您的需求。